Tato jedine\u010dn\u00e1 slo\u017een\u00ed jim d\u00e1v\u00e1 v\u00fdjime\u010dn\u00e9 magnetick\u00e9 vlastnosti, kter\u00e9 p\u0159ed\u010d\u00ed mnoho tradi\u010dn\u00edch magnet\u016f. Ve srovn\u00e1n\u00ed s ferritov\u00fdmi, Alnico a samarium-kobaltov\u00fdmi (SmCo) magnety nab\u00edzej\u00ed NdFeB magnety nejvy\u0161\u0161\u00ed magnetickou s\u00edlu, co\u017e je \u010din\u00ed ide\u00e1ln\u00edmi pro aplikace, kde je pot\u0159eba siln\u00fd, kompaktn\u00ed magnet.<\/p>\n<p>Z hlediska v\u00fdkonu poskytuj\u00ed NdFeB magnety siln\u00e9 magnetick\u00e9 pole s vynikaj\u00edc\u00ed hustotou energie. To znamen\u00e1, \u017ee mohou vytv\u00e1\u0159et vynikaj\u00edc\u00ed magnetickou s\u00edlu i v men\u0161\u00edch velikostech. Ferritov\u00e9 magnety jsou sice cenov\u011b dostupn\u00e9, maj\u00ed v\u0161ak ni\u017e\u0161\u00ed magnetickou s\u00edlu, a magnety Alnico obvykle nab\u00edzej\u00ed men\u0161\u00ed odolnost v\u016f\u010di demagnetizaci. Magnety SmCo jsou odoln\u00e9, ale obvykle dra\u017e\u0161\u00ed a maj\u00ed ni\u017e\u0161\u00ed maxim\u00e1ln\u00ed energetick\u00fd produkt ne\u017e NdFeB magnety.<\/p>\n<p>NdFeB magnety vynikaj\u00ed tak\u00e9 svou odolnost\u00ed a rozsahem provozn\u00edch teplot. I kdy\u017e jejich optim\u00e1ln\u00ed v\u00fdkon je v prost\u0159ed\u00edch pod 80\u00b0C (176\u00b0F), nov\u011bj\u0161\u00ed t\u0159\u00eddy sn\u00e1\u0161ej\u00ed teploty a\u017e do 160\u00b0C (320\u00b0F), co\u017e je \u010din\u00ed vhodn\u00fdmi pro mnoho pr\u016fmyslov\u00fdch pou\u017eit\u00ed. Spr\u00e1vn\u00e9 povlaky a o\u0161et\u0159en\u00ed d\u00e1le zvy\u0161uj\u00ed jejich odolnost v\u016f\u010di korozi a mechanick\u00e9mu opot\u0159eben\u00ed, co\u017e zaji\u0161\u0165uje dlouhov\u011bkost v n\u00e1ro\u010dn\u00fdch podm\u00ednk\u00e1ch. Funguje tak, \u017ee p\u0159itahuje a zachycuje feromagnetick\u00e9 \u010d\u00e1stice, \u010d\u00edm\u017e je odd\u011bluje od nemagnetick\u00fdch materi\u00e1l\u016f. Tento proces pom\u00e1h\u00e1 chr\u00e1nit stroje, zlep\u0161ovat kvalitu produkt\u016f a z\u00edsk\u00e1vat cenn\u00e9 kovy.<\/p>\n<p>Existuje n\u011bkolik typ\u016f magnetick\u00fdch separ\u00e1tor\u016f, v\u010detn\u011b:<\/p>\n<ul>\n<li><strong>Such\u00e9 magnetick\u00e9 separ\u00e1tory:<\/strong> Pou\u017e\u00edvaj\u00ed se pro such\u00e9 materi\u00e1ly jako pr\u00e1\u0161ky a granule, \u010dasto v odv\u011btv\u00edch jako t\u011b\u017eba a potravin\u00e1\u0159stv\u00ed.<\/li>\n<li><strong>Mokr\u00e9 magnetick\u00e9 separ\u00e1tory:<\/strong> Ur\u010deny pro suspenze nebo kapaln\u00e9 sm\u011bsi, b\u011b\u017en\u00e9 v mineralogii.<\/li>\n<li><strong>Overband magnety:<\/strong> Instalovan\u00e9 nad dopravn\u00edky, aby zachytily odpadov\u00e9 kovy bez zastaven\u00ed v\u00fdroby.<\/li>\n<li><strong>Kruhov\u00e9 magnety:<\/strong> Rotuj\u00ed pro nep\u0159etr\u017eit\u00e9 odd\u011blov\u00e1n\u00ed magnetick\u00fdch \u010d\u00e1stic od hromadn\u00fdch materi\u00e1l\u016f na dopravn\u00edc\u00edch.<\/li>\n<\/ul>\n<p>Magnetick\u00e9 separ\u00e1tory jsou \u0161iroce pou\u017e\u00edv\u00e1ny v odv\u011btv\u00edch jako t\u011b\u017eba, recyklace, potravin\u00e1\u0159stv\u00ed, farmacie a v\u00fdroba. Pom\u00e1haj\u00ed odstra\u0148ovat kontaminanty, z\u00edsk\u00e1vat kovy a zaji\u0161\u0165ovat plynul\u00fd provoz v zpracovatelsk\u00fdch link\u00e1ch. Zde je n\u011bkolik jednoduch\u00fdch tip\u016f, kter\u00e9 v\u00e1m pomohou bezpe\u010dn\u011b a efektivn\u011b nastavit a udr\u017eovat tyto v\u00fdkonn\u00e9 magnety:<\/p>\n<h3>Nejlep\u0161\u00ed postupy pro instalaci<\/h3>\n<ul>\n<li><strong>Opatrn\u011b s manipulac\u00ed:<\/strong> Magnety NdFeB jsou k\u0159ehk\u00e9 a mohou se od\u0161t\u00edpnout nebo prasknout p\u0159i p\u00e1du. Pou\u017e\u00edvejte rukavice a vyh\u00fdbejte se n\u00e1hl\u00fdm n\u00e1raz\u016fm b\u011bhem instalace.<\/li>\n<li><strong>Zabezpe\u010den\u00e9 upevn\u011bn\u00ed:<\/strong> Ujist\u011bte se, \u017ee magnety jsou pevn\u011b upevn\u011bny na m\u00edst\u011b, aby nedoch\u00e1zelo k pohybu b\u011bhem provozu. Voln\u00e9 magnety mohou sn\u00ed\u017eit \u00fa\u010dinnost separace a po\u0161kodit za\u0159\u00edzen\u00ed.<\/li>\n<li><strong>Dodr\u017eujte polaritu:<\/strong> Zkontrolujte, \u017ee jsou magnety instalov\u00e1ny s spr\u00e1vnou polaritou, aby se maximalizovala magnetick\u00e1 s\u00edla a zajistila optim\u00e1ln\u00ed separace materi\u00e1lu.<\/li>\n<li><strong>Vyhn\u011bte se p\u0159eh\u0159\u00e1t\u00ed:<\/strong> Neexponujte magnety teplot\u00e1m vy\u0161\u0161\u00edm, ne\u017e jsou jejich jmenovit\u00e9 limity, b\u011bhem instalace nebo provozu, proto\u017ee to m\u016f\u017ee zp\u016fsobit trvalou ztr\u00e1tu magnetismu.<\/li>\n<\/ul>\n<h3>Pravideln\u00e9 kontroly pro udr\u017een\u00ed v\u00fdkonu<\/h3>\n<ul>\n<li><strong>Vizu\u00e1ln\u00ed kontrola:<\/strong> Pravideln\u011b kontrolujte praskliny, od\u0161t\u00edpnut\u00ed nebo korozi. Po\u0161kozen\u00e9 magnety mohou oslabit magnetickou s\u00edlu a zp\u016fsobit riziko kontaminace.<\/li>\n<li><strong>Test magnetick\u00e9 s\u00edly:<\/strong> Pou\u017e\u00edvejte gaussmetr k m\u011b\u0159en\u00ed magnetick\u00e9 s\u00edly v intervalech. Pokles m\u016f\u017ee nazna\u010dovat demagnetizaci nebo po\u0161kozen\u00ed.<\/li>\n<li><strong>\u010cistota povrch\u016f:<\/strong> Udr\u017eujte jak magnety, tak povrchy separ\u00e1toru bez ne\u010distot, oleje nebo kovov\u00fdch zbytk\u016f, aby byla zachov\u00e1na pln\u00e1 magnetick\u00e1 s\u00edla.<\/li>\n<\/ul>\n<h3>B\u011b\u017en\u00e9 probl\u00e9my a jejich \u0159e\u0161en\u00ed<\/h3>\n<ul>\n<li><strong>Riziko demagnetizace:<\/strong> Vysok\u00e9 teploty nebo siln\u00e1 protich\u016fdn\u00e1 magnetick\u00e1 pole mohou oslabit magnety NdFeB. Pe\u010dliv\u011b kontrolujte provozn\u00ed podm\u00ednky.<\/li>\n<li><strong>Koroze:<\/strong> A\u010dkoliv mnoho NdFeB magnet\u016f m\u00e1 ochrann\u00e9 vrstvy, ty se mohou opot\u0159ebovat. Znovu naneste vrstvy nebo vym\u011b\u0148te magnety, pokud se objev\u00ed koroze.<\/li>\n<li><strong>Mechanick\u00e9 po\u0161kozen\u00ed:<\/strong> Vibrace nebo n\u00e1razy b\u011bhem pou\u017e\u00edv\u00e1n\u00ed mohou uvolnit nebo po\u0161kodit magnety. Pravideln\u011b kontrolujte upevn\u011bn\u00ed a podpory.<\/li>\n<\/ul>\n<h3>Tipy pro optimalizaci \u017eivotnosti<\/h3>\n<ul>\n<li>Ukl\u00e1dejte n\u00e1hradn\u00ed magnety na such\u00e1, chladn\u00e1 m\u00edsta mimo kovov\u00e9 p\u0159edm\u011bty a teplo.<\/li>\n<li>Napl\u00e1nujte \u00fadr\u017ebov\u00e9 odst\u00e1vky pro d\u016fkladn\u00e9 inspekce a \u010di\u0161t\u011bn\u00ed.<\/li>\n<li>Pou\u017e\u00edvejte vlastn\u00ed vrstvy nebo n\u00e1vleky navr\u017een\u00e9 va\u0161\u00edm dodavatelem NdFeB magnet\u016f pro zv\u00fd\u0161en\u00ed odolnosti proti korozi a opot\u0159eben\u00ed.<\/li>\n<li>Spolupracujte s v\u00fdrobci, jako je NBAEM, pro individu\u00e1ln\u00ed rady a podporu v p\u00e9\u010di o magnety.<\/li>\n<\/ul>\n<p>Dodr\u017eov\u00e1n\u00edm t\u011bchto jednoduch\u00fdch krok\u016f udr\u017e\u00edte sv\u00e9 NdFeB magnety v magnetick\u00fdch separ\u00e1torech siln\u00e9 a efektivn\u00ed po mnoho let, \u010d\u00edm\u017e u\u0161et\u0159\u00edte n\u00e1klady na opravy a odst\u00e1vky.<\/p>\n<h2>Porovn\u00e1n\u00ed NdFeB magnet\u016f s jin\u00fdmi typy magnet\u016f v magnetick\u00e9 separaci<\/h2>\n<p><img decoding=\"async\" src=\"https:\/\/nbaem.com\/wp-content\/uploads\/2025\/09\/NdFeB_Magnets_Cost_Performance_Comparison_laBqee3N.webp\" alt=\"Porovn\u00e1n\u00ed n\u00e1kladov\u00e9ho v\u00fdkonu magnet\u016f NdFeB\" \/><\/p>\n<p>Fotografie od\u00a0 <strong><span style=\"color: #ff6600;\"><a href=\"https:\/\/www.credenceresearch.com\/report\/neodymium-iron-boron-ndfeb-magnet-market\" target=\"_blank\" rel=\"noopener\">Credence V\u00fdzkum<\/a>.<\/span><\/strong><\/p>\n<p>Pokud jde o magnetick\u00e9 separ\u00e1tory, v\u00fdb\u011br spr\u00e1vn\u00e9ho magnetu m\u016f\u017ee ud\u011blat velk\u00fd rozd\u00edl.
